    Yes, let’s keep drafting fake “generational”, “never seen before” edge rushers who don’t get second contracts with team!

    “Drafting (and reaching) for a QB, the same thing that’s led to the inept franchise we’ve been since 2002…”

    They’ve drafted 2 QBs in the first round.
    David Carr
    Deshaun Watson

    David Carr was 20 years ago.
    You act like this is a common occurrence for them. Like they constantly reach on bad QBs.

    Yes we get it, you don’t like this QB class so kick the can down the road (at least one more year).
    They may not like this class either. I have no idea. If they don’t, fine. No, they shouldn’t reach for one.

    Fact of the matter is they don’t have their long term coach or their long term QB.
    Yes, they’ll need a CB and edge rusher and LT and everything else but until they find a QB…

    Colts were thought to have a good roster. They don’t have a QB(and haven’t since Luck retired). So they’re not very good.
    Saints/Steelers have ready made teams. Surprise, surprise, 1-3 and don’t have a QB.
    Browns have a good roster. They didn’t think they could win with Baker so they go get Deshaun.
    Where did the great Von Miller and Bradley Chubb and Chris Harris and Bradley Roby take the Broncos after Manning retired? Oh right, they didn’t have a QB.
    On and on and on…

    So yes, you can have Will Anderson, Derek Stingley and Jalen Pitre and they’ll be good, they’ll be fine. Also probably be sitting at home the 3rd week of January.
